Rigudi

Rigudi is a village located in the Para Subdivision of Purulia district,West Bengal, India. Rigudi has a population of 2156 as recorded in the 2011 Census. It falls under the jurisdiction of Bowridih Gram Panchayat and the Para Block Panchayat in Para District. The village has 391 households and is identified by village code 330108. Rigudi is located in the 723155 postal area, contributing significantly to the rural administrative structure of Para Sub-District.

Total Population of Rigudi

As of the 2011 census, Population of Rigudi has a population of approximately 2156 people, where the male population is 1109 and the female population is 1047.

Total 2156
Male 1109
Female 1047

Household in Rigudi

There are approximately 391 households in Rigudi. The average household size in the village is about 5 persons per house.

Type Stats
Household 391
People / Family 5

Understanding Literacy Rates in Rigudi Village

As per the 2011 Census, Rigudi presents important statistics regarding its literacy and illiteracy rates.

Literacy in Rigudi Village (2011):

Total 1252
Male 817
Female 435

illiteracy in Rigudi Village (2011):

Total 904
Male 292
Female 612
